NBRC TMC Exam Overview
The National Board for Respiratory Care (NBRC) administers the Therapist Multiple-Choice (TMC) examination, which is the primary certification exam for respiratory therapists in the United States. The TMC exam serves a dual purpose: it determines eligibility for both the Certified Respiratory Therapist (CRT) credential and the Registered Respiratory Therapist (RRT) credential.

Understanding the Scoring System
The TMC exam contains 160 total questions, but only 140 are scored. The remaining 20 are pretest items that NBRC is evaluating for future exams. You will not know which questions are pretest items, so treat every question as if it counts.
- CRT Credential: Score 86 or higher on the 140 scored items
- RRT Eligibility: Score 92 or higher on the 140 scored items, then pass the CSE
- If you score between 86 and 91, you earn the CRT but are not eligible for the CSE
Clinical Simulation Exam (CSE)
Candidates who achieve an RRT-eligible score on the TMC must then pass the Clinical Simulation Exam (CSE):

The CSE presents you with patient scenarios where you must make clinical decisions. Unlike multiple-choice questions, the CSE requires you to gather information, evaluate data, and select appropriate interventions in a simulated clinical environment.
Remote Proctoring Option
PSI offers remote proctoring as an alternative to testing at a physical test center:
- Take the exam from your home or a quiet, private location
- Requires a computer with webcam, microphone, and stable internet
- Same exam content and timing as in-person testing
- Government-issued photo ID required
- Your testing space must be free of notes, reference materials, and other people
